CVE-2025-68811
This CVE-2025-68811 concerns the Linux kernel svcrdma path. The root cause is in svc_rdma_copy_inline_range where rc_curpage (page index) was used in the page base instead of the byte offset rc_pageoff, causing memcpy operations to land incorrectly within a page.
